Поделиться через


Определение представления источника данных

После определения источников данных, используемых в проекте служб Службы Analysis Services, на следующем этапе, как правило, определяется представление источника данных для этого проекта. Представление источника данных является отдельным единым представлением метаданных из указанных таблиц и представлений, определяемых источником данных для проекта. Хранение метаданных в представлении источника данных позволяет работать с метаданными в процессе разработки, не устанавливая соединений с базовыми источниками данных. Дополнительные сведения см. в разделе Представления источников данных в многомерных моделях.

В следующей задаче будет определено представление источника данных, которое содержит пять таблиц из источника данных AdventureWorksDW2012.

Определение нового представления источника данных

  1. В обозревателе решений (в правой части окна Microsoft Visual Studio) щелкните правой кнопкой мыши папку Представления источников данных и выберите Создать представление источника данных.

  2. На странице Вас приветствует мастер представления источника данных нажмите кнопку Далее. Будет открыта страница Выбор источника данных.

  3. В группе Источник реляционных данных выбран источник данных Adventure Works DW 2012. Нажмите кнопку Далее.

    ПримечаниеПримечание

    Чтобы создать представление источника данных, в основе которого лежат несколько источников данных, необходимо предварительно определить представление источника данных, основанное на одном источнике данных. Этот источник данных впоследствии считается первичным источником данных. Затем можно добавить таблицы и представления из вторичного источника данных. При проектировании измерений с атрибутами, основанными на связанных таблицах нескольких источников данных, может потребоваться определить источник данных Microsoft SQL Server как основной источник данных, чтобы использовать его возможности обработки распределенных запросов.

  4. На странице Выбор таблиц и представлений выберите таблицы и представления из списка объектов, доступных в выбранном источнике данных. Можно установить для этого списка фильтр, который поможет отобрать нужные таблицы и представления.

    ПримечаниеПримечание

    Нажмите кнопку разворачивания в верхнем правом углу, чтобы окно заняло весь экран. Это облегчит просмотр полного списка доступных объектов.

    В списке Доступные объекты выберите следующие объекты. Несколько таблиц можно выбрать, удерживая клавишу CTRL при выборе.

    • DimCustomer (dbo)

    • DimDate (dbo)

    • DimGeography (dbo)

    • DimProduct (dbo)

    • FactInternetSales (dbo)

  5. Нажмите кнопку >, чтобы добавить выбранные таблицы в список Включенные объекты.

  6. Нажмите кнопку Далее.

  7. Убедитесь, что в поле «Имя» введено Adventure Works DW 2012, и затем нажмите кнопку Готово.

    Представление источника данных Adventure Works DW 2012 будет выведено в папке Представления источников данных обозревателя решений. Содержимое представления источника данных также отображается в конструкторе представлений источников данных в среде SQL Server Data Tools (SSDT). В этом конструкторе содержатся следующие элементы:

    • Панель Диаграмма, на которой представлены в графическом виде таблицы и их связи.

    • Панель Таблицы, на которой отображаются в виде дерева таблицы и их элементы схем.

    • Панель Организатор схем, на которой можно создавать вложенные диаграммы, позволяющие просматривать поднаборы этого представления источника данных.

    • Панель инструментов конструктора представлений источников данных.

  8. Нажмите кнопку Развернуть, чтобы развернуть окно среды разработки MicrosoftVisual Studio.

  9. На панели инструментов в верхней части конструктора представлений источников данных щелкните значок Масштаб, чтобы просмотреть таблицы на панели Диаграмма в масштабе 50%. При этом будут скрыты подробные сведения в столбцах таблиц.

  10. Чтобы скрыть обозреватель решений, нажмите кнопку Автоматически скрыть, на которой изображен значок кнопки, в заголовке обозревателя решений. Чтобы вернуться в обозреватель решений, установите указатель над вкладкой «Обозреватель решений» в правой части среды разработки. Чтобы раскрыть обозреватель решений, вновь нажмите кнопку Автоматически скрыть.

  11. Если окна не скрыты по умолчанию, нажмите кнопку Автоматически скрыть в заголовке окна свойств или обозревателя решений.

    Теперь все таблицы и связи между ними можно легко просматривать на панели Диаграмма. Обратите внимание, что между таблицами FactInternetSales и DimDate имеются три связи. С каждой продажей связано три даты: дата заказа, дата оплаты и дата отгрузки. Чтобы просмотреть подробные сведения по связи, дважды щелкните стрелку этой связи на панели Диаграмма.

Следующая задача занятия

Изменение имен таблиц по умолчанию

См. также

Основные понятия

Представления источников данных в многомерных моделях